I started collecting steins to reclaim some of my roots. I grew up in a German-American neighborhood in the Mid-Atlantic. Several of my friend's father had a basement bar, complete with old German beer ads and beer steins. When I finally bought my own house, I recreated that look in my basement, and started adding to the steins that were gifted to me over the years. I will never have hundreds of them, but I probably have about 30, 15 of which are true antiques - several are cheap, and I just like the look of them. Prost!
